The Boston Bruins have made a significant roster move by claiming defenseman Vladislav Kolyachonok off waivers from the Florida Panthers. Kolyachonok, the 22-year-old blueliner, is known for his solid two-way play and has the potential to add depth to the Bruins' defensive lineup. After joining the Panthers as a prospect, Kolyachonok played in a limited capacity but showed flashes of talent during his time in the AHL.

The Bruins, who have consistently been contenders in the Eastern Conference, aim to bolster their defense as they navigate the challenging regular season. Kolyachonok’s addition could be beneficial, especially with injuries often affecting team performance throughout the season. His experience in the AHL could help him transition effectively into the NHL, allowing him to contribute alongside established NHL talent in Boston.

As the season progresses, it will be interesting to see how Kolyachonok adjusts to playing with the Bruins and whether he can earn a permanent spot within the lineup. Fans are optimistic about what this young player can bring to the team as they strive for another deep playoff run. Kolyachonok's defensive skills paired with a potential offensive upside make him a player to watch moving forward.
